Apple purchased speech recognition firm Novauris last year to bolster Siri team

Just a day after Microsoft unveiled itsdigital assistant ‘Cortana’to rave reviews, news has surfaced that Apple has been making moves to bring its own assistant up to speed. TechCrunch is reporting this morning that the Cupertino company has purchased speech recognition firm Novauris, and the group is now working on the Siri team. Novauris is highly-regarded in the world of speech recognition. Founded in March 2002 by well-known speech researchers and exDragon Systemsengineers, the firm’s technology is used in a variety of products by companies like Verizon Wireless, Panasonic, Alpine and BMW, and can be operated in both the embedded and server space…...
